Serengeti Asset Management and Life Capital Partners Sign with Half of the Clubs in the Brazilian Championship to Purchase a 20% Interest in their Media and Commercial Rights

Under the agreements, the investor group will purchase a 20% stake in the media and commercial rights of the participating teams for fifty (50) years, starting in 2025.

National Nonprofit, Founders First CDC, Awards $100,000 to Southern California Businesses

SAN DIEGO, Dec. 15, 2022 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Founders First CDC, a national 501(c)(3) non-profit organization that empowers expansion in diverse, founder-led, revenue-generating businesses, announced the winners of its new Job Creators Quest Grant today during a virtual press conference. More than 1,500 Southern California businesses applied for the grants and 30 recipients were selected, with minority and underrepresented business owners receiving $100,000, collectively in cash and full tuition scholarships to a Founders First CDC Business Accelerator Program. The grant recipients were selected from throughout the Southern California region, including Los Angeles, Orange County, Riverside, San Bernardino, Imperial, and San Diego regions, serving a variety of industries – from construction and manufacturing to STEM and healthcare, to hospitality, and more.
